If an angle is bisected to form two new 10 degree angles, what was the measure of the original angle?

Answer:

20 degrees

Step-by-step explanation:

Bisected means to cut or divide in half. After knowing this you should realize that the two new parts of the angle should be equal. They are both ten degrees, so to get the measure of the original angle add both of the sides together.

10+10=20
